AN IMPRESSIVE 20 members of Farsley-based Leeds Karate Academy, including Bradford schoolgirl Emelye O'Brien and local schoolboy Joe Hird, have won national call-ups.

They have been selected for the Japan Karate Shotorenmei (JKS) England national elite squad for 2015.

Junior kumite choices were Georgia Freer, Hird, Sarah Howarth, David Lister, Laura Mackintosh, Isaac Mitchell, Seb Mitchell, Daniel Smith and Alice Whittington, while senior call-ups went to Stephen Brown, Joe Bulmer, Richard Fewkes, Mell Finlay, Joe Hart, Tom Little, Tom Mitchell, Tony Mitchell, O'Brien, Ashley Scott and Jordan Weatherley.

Joe Hird, Sarah Howarth and Jordan Weatherley are also part of the kata squad.

The group will now train with the JKS national squad throughout the year and be invited to several national and international championships, including the JKS World Championships in South Africa.
